they are still flying, nov been a quite month for all, been doing Miami for P and O, plus Lagos, and stuff for Air Mauritus. however gearing up for 1 a/c to go to KL for hadj, and 2 to saudi, 1 back from usa after having 4 doors added, and a little light refurbishing, i.e more seats.

also a full programme for Travel City Direct next year, rumors are, 4 or 5 flights from LGW to SFB, and 3 or 4 from MAN to SFB.

So far sale not affected us much, as Bath family ( behind Bath Travel ) have brought us, and want to keep us as the same, with a few improvements I am sure.

Engineer Thanks for your comment. Not appreciated. to start saying we won't get our money when we have been told we will get something by the end of June / beginning of July through Moore Stephens.



Moku Ozjet has been on the tail of minardi for most of the season. Yes it is a slap in the face but it is also nice knowing that Ozjet has not been given the go ahead. The problem with Paul Stoddart is that he has lots of companies some with money, some without. EAAC has no money and has since gone in to a CVA. I know it is not fair on us that have no job and are owed money but we will be getting something, not much but something anyway. I can see why he won't transfer some of his money around, he has made money from his other companies and it is his money so he has the choice of what to do with it. If he had any sense of kindness or any heart whatsoever he would do the right thing, but as we all know, that is not going to happen.
